About Sunnyview House
Sunnyview House is a nursing home in Leeds, registered with the Care Quality Commission for up to 84 residents. It provides care for people living with dementia, older people and younger adults. It is run by BUPA Group, which operates 121 care homes in England. The home has been registered since January 2011.
At its latest inspection, published August 2025, the CQC rated Sunnyview House Good, which means the CQC found the service performing well and meeting its expectations. Ratings can change after a new inspection, so check the CQC report before you visit.
Sunnyview House has not published its fees and has not yet confirmed them to us. Care homes in Leeds with a fee on record typically charge about £1,322 a week for residential care and £1,409 for nursing care, so expect a figure in that range and ask the home for a written quote.
